About the NVIDIA GeForce GTX 870M GPU

The NVIDIA GeForce GTX 870M is an end-of-life mobile graphics card that released in Q1 2014. It is built on the Kepler GPU microarchitecture (codename GK104) and is manufactured on a 28 nm process.

Memory

The GTX 870M has 3 GB of GDDR5 memory, with a 1,250 MHz memory clock and a 192 bit interface. This gives it a memory bandwidth of 120 Gb/s, which affects how fast it can transfer data to and from memory. GPU memory stores temporary data that helps the GPU with complex math and graphics operations. More memory is generally better, as not having enough can cause performance bottlenecks.

Cores and Clock Speeds

The GTX 870M includes 1,344 CUDA cores, the processing units for handling parallel computing tasks. The GPU operates at a core clock speed of 941 MHz and can dynamically boost its clock speed up to 967 MHz. Complementing the processing units are 112 texture mapping units (TMUs) for efficient texture filtering and 24 render output units (ROPs) for pixel processing.

Compatibility & Power Consumption

The GPU has a thermal design power (TDP) of 100 W. A power supply not strong enough to handle this might result in system crashes and potentially damage your hardware.

About the NVIDIA GeForce RTX 2080 Ti GPU

The NVIDIA GeForce RTX 2080 Ti is a desktop graphics card that launched in Q3 2018 with a MSRP of $999. It is built on the Turing GPU microarchitecture (codename TU102) and is manufactured on a 12 nm process.

Memory

The RTX 2080 Ti has 11 GB of GDDR6 memory, with a 1,750 MHz memory clock and a 352 bit interface. This gives it a memory bandwidth of 616 Gb/s, which affects how fast it can transfer data to and from memory. GPU memory stores temporary data that helps the GPU with complex math and graphics operations. More memory is generally better, as not having enough can cause performance bottlenecks.

Cores and Clock Speeds

The RTX 2080 Ti includes 4,352 CUDA cores, the processing units for handling parallel computing tasks. The GPU operates at a core clock speed of 1,350 MHz and can dynamically boost its clock speed up to 1,545 MHz. Complementing the processing units are 272 texture mapping units (TMUs) for efficient texture filtering and 88 render output units (ROPs) for pixel processing. Additionally, the GPU features 544 tensor cores optimized for AI-accelerated workloads and 68 RT cores dedicated to real-time ray tracing calculations.

Compatibility & Power Consumption

The RTX 2080 Ti occupies 2 PCIe expansion slots. It supports HDMI 2.0, DisplayPort 1.4a, USB Type-C display connections. NVIDIA recommends a power supply of at least 600 W to handle the GPU's thermal design power (TDP) of 250 W.
